- Custodial History
- These papers were collected as part of a comprehensive study into the life and career of Colonel Thomas Talbot, the early nineteenth-century settlement agent whose authority extended over much of what is now southwestern Ontario. The research was conducted by Guy St-Denis in various archival repositories with the intention of publishing a new biography of Talbot. After the project was discontinued, the photocopied documents were preserved in hopes of being useful to future scholars of Talbot and his settlement. The files were compiled ca. 1985-2003.

- History / Biographical
- In 1903, the City and district celebrated the Centennial of the founding of the Talbot Settlement at Port Talbot on May 21st, 1803. The affair was a week long succession of celebrations.
- Scope and Content
- Black and white photograph showing Judge Ermatinger and Dr. Bartlett placing records and coins in the Talbot Settlement Centennial Cairn at Pinafore Park during the Talbot Centennial Celebrations in 1903. Contractor G.A. Ponsford is in the foreground. File includes:

- Scope and Content
- K.W. McKay: Records relating to the Talbot Settlement and Port Talbot. Includes the following records:
- -agenda and programme for a "Banquet under the Auspices of the Elgin Historical Society and Scientific Institute in Commemoration of the One Hundredth Anniversary of the Talbot Settlement: Grand Central Hotel, St. Thomas, 21st May, 1903".
- -programme for the Unveiling of the Port Talbot Memorial, June 30, 1926.
- -a speech given by K.W. McKay at the Unveiling of the Port Talbot Memorial, 1926.
- -newspaper clipping: "Cairn Commemorates Great Colonizer", 1926.
- -newspaper article: "On Colonel Talbot's 155th Birthday Flag Is Raised on Spot Where Founder Landed", July 19, 1926.
